  • Trauma Art Narrative Therapy Workshop – May 3, 2013

    Trauma Art Narrative Therapy (TANT) is a creative narrative cognitive exposure technique that provides trauma resolution. TANT is designed to help resolve trauma-based symptoms and behaviors in order for traumatized individuals to move on to the next step in their healing.
